
/*** 
====================================================================
	Ozp Contact Section
====================================================================
***/
.vcp-contact-sec h2 {
    font-size: 28px;
}
.vcp-contact-sec .vcp-contact-list li{
    display: flex;
    margin-bottom: 30px;
    box-shadow: 0px 2px 5px rgb(0 0 0 / 15%);
    border-radius: 7px;
    width: 88%;
    color:rgba(0,0,0,.8);
    overflow: hidden;
}
.vcp-contact-sec .vcp-contact-list .txt{
	padding: 10px 10px 10px 20px;
	width: 100%;
}
.vcp-contact-sec .vcp-contact-list .ico{
	background: var(--color-2);
	color: var(--white-color);
	width: 50px;
	min-width: 50px;
	font-size: 26px;
}
.vcp-contact-sec .vcp-contact-list li:nth-child(2){
	margin: 0 0 30px 30px;
}
.vcp-contact-sec .vcp-contact-list li:nth-child(2) .ico{
	background: var(--color-1);
}
.vcp-contact-sec .vcp-contact-list li:nth-child(3) .ico{
	background: var(--color-3);
}
.vcp-contact-sec .vcp-contact-list li .contact-txt a{
	font-size: 16px;
}
.vcp-contact-sec .vcp-contact-list a{
	color:rgba(0,0,0,.8);
}
.vcp-contact-sec .vcp-contact-list strong {
    color: var(--color-2);
    font-size: 20px;
    font-weight: 600;
}


.vcp-contact-sec .vcp-contact-form{
	box-shadow: rgba(17, 17, 26, 0.1) 0px 0px 16px;
	padding: 30px;
}
.vcp-form-block .input-group-text {
    border-color: #e5e5e5;
    color: var(--grey-color);
}
.vcp-form-block label{
	color: var(--grey-color);
}
.vcp-form-block .btn{
	padding: 8px 25px;
}